How to use these affirmations (practical tips)
Pick two or three that resonate and use them consistently. Here are a few simple ways to make them stick:
- Say them out loud each morning or night for 12 minutes.
- Write one on a sticky note and place it where you'll see it often (mirror, fridge, workspace).
- Set a weekly phone reminder with a short affirmation to interrupt autopilot and recalibrate your mindset.
- Pair affirmations with deep breaths inhale while thinking the first half, exhale with the second.
- Personalize them: change wording so they feel true and believable to you.
Closing thought
Affirmations arent magic spells theyre tiny, repeated reminders that reshape how you talk to yourself. Over time, gentle, consistent practice can soften self-doubt and make room for more confidence and calm. Try a few of these for a week and notice how your inner voice begins to change.
